Key Insights of Japan Roof Tent Market

  • Market Size (2023): Estimated at approximately $150 million, with steady growth driven by outdoor recreation trends.
  • Forecast Value (2026): Projected to reach $250 million, reflecting a CAGR of around 14% over the next three years.
  • Dominant Segment: Premium, lightweight, and technologically integrated roof tents targeting urban outdoor enthusiasts and adventure travelers.
  • Primary Application: Recreational camping, overlanding, and eco-tourism activities, with a rising interest in sustainable outdoor gear.
  • Leading Geography: The Kanto and Kansai regions dominate sales, driven by urban populations and affluent consumer bases.
  • Market Opportunity: Expansion into rural and suburban markets, leveraging Japan’s aging population’s outdoor recreation interest.
  • Major Competitors: Local brands like NAPAPIJRI and international players such as Thule and iKamper are competing for market share.

Dynamic Market Forces Shaping Japan Roof Tent Industry

Porter’s Five Forces analysis reveals a competitive landscape characterized by high buyer power, owing to discerning consumers demanding premium quality and innovative features. Supplier power is moderate, with key raw materials like lightweight aluminum and durable fabrics sourced globally, subject to supply chain fluctuations. Threats from new entrants are mitigated by high capital requirements and strict regulatory compliance, yet niche startups with innovative offerings are emerging.

Substitutes such as traditional camping tents and vehicle-mounted awnings present competitive challenges, but roof tents’ convenience and safety advantages sustain their appeal. The bargaining power of existing competitors is high, necessitating continuous innovation and strategic partnerships. Overall, the industry’s profitability hinges on technological differentiation, brand loyalty, and the ability to adapt swiftly to evolving consumer preferences and environmental policies.
